Charles F. Velardo

July 17, 1918 — May 16, 2009

Charles F. Velardo, of Dover, died May 16, 2009.

Beloved husband to Anna J. (Norton) Velardo for 70 years. Devoted father to Sunni Morgan, Priscilla Velardo and Valerie Velardo, all of Dover. Grandfather of Anthony Pagliazzo and his wife Pauline of Medway and Charles Pagliazzo and his wife Rebecca of Medfield. Great-grandfather of James and Joseph Pagliazzo of Medfield and Arabella and Dante Pagliazzo of Medway. Dear friend of Sandra Adams and Sally Itterly, both of Dover. Brother of the late Anthony Velardo and Jeanne Picard and dear cousin of Roberta Fatalo of Wakefield.

Charles was born in Boston and grew up first in Roxbury and then Hyde Park. A proud graduate of Boston Latin School, he attended Boston college and worked for both the department of Navy and the department of Labor prior to entering the private sector.

He was a principal and vice-president of G. Salvucci and Company in Newton for over 30 years. During and after his career with Salvucci and Company, he was a leader in the advancement of the Masonry industry; founder of the International Masonry Institute, and the International Council of Employers of Bricklayers & Allied Craftworkers, trustee of the Bricklayers and Allied Craftsmen Local No. 3, and past president of both the Masonry Contractors of Massachusetts and the Mason Contractors Association of America. Mr. Velardo was a member of the Ancient and Honorable Artillery Company of Massachusetts, and had a life-long devotion to the Mission Church of Roxbury and Our Lady of Perpetual Help.
